How exposed is Thorntonville to wildfire?

Very High
80thpercentile nationally

USFS's Wildfire Risk to Communities model puts Thorntonville at the 80th national percentile for risk to structures, in USFS's highest wildfire-risk band nationally — a score built from 525 actual buildings. (Source: USFS's Wildfire Risk to Communities methodology.)

Fire likelihood alone (USFS's burn-probability figure) ranks Thorntonville at the 77th national percentile — 4 points below its risk-to-structures score, a gap driven by how much is actually built there.

What "at risk" means for the buildings here

525Total buildings
53.7%Direct exposure
46.3%Indirect exposure
0%Minimal exposure

USFS classifies 53.7% of Thorntonville's buildings as Direct exposure, higher than its 46.3% Indirect share and far above its 0% Minimal share — a profile where 282 structures sit close enough to vegetation that lot clearing matters most.

How Thorntonville compares

Inside Texas, Thorntonville sits at just the 61st percentile even though it scores 80th nationally — the state's overall wildfire exposure is high enough to make this a relatively quiet corner of it. Among the 31,521 US communities USFS scores, Thorntonville ranks 6,286 for wildfire risk (1 is highest) and 16,951 by building count (1 is largest).
